I realized I haven’t created a new inspiration board for y’all in so long, so I decided it was high time to piece together my current favorites using an all too appropriate source: the fall.
Fall to me means watching the leaves on the trees change from green to brilliant orange and red. It means filling wedding palettes with both colors in addition to navy and brown. It’s a time to break out your layers and pair them with your wedding dress (hello, plaid shirts!) and add quilts and blankets to lounges to keep guests cozy. Fall does not mean that vintage is no longer appropriate. No, no. Bring on the tea cups and crystal chandeliers all year long. Without further ado, inspiration for a rustic vintage fall wedding that I would love to plan (or attend):
